About

In recent decades, authors affiliated with Guangxi Normal University have published 9.5k papers, which have received a total of 143.9k indexed citations. Scholars at this organization have produced 1.6k papers in Molecular Biology, 1.5k papers in Materials Chemistry and 1.3k papers in Electrical and Electronic Engineering on the topics of Metal-Organic Frameworks: Synthesis and Applications (525 papers), Advanced biosensing and bioanalysis techniques (505 papers) and Metal complexes synthesis and properties (497 papers). Their work is cited by papers focused on Materials Chemistry (31.7k citations), Electrical and Electronic Engineering (25.1k citations) and Molecular Biology (24.1k citations). Authors at Guangxi Normal University collaborate with scholars in China, United States and Australia and have published in prestigious journals including Nature, Proceedings of the National Academy of Sciences and Physical Review Letters. Some of Guangxi Normal University's most productive authors include Shulin Zhao, Ming‐Hua Zeng, Hong Liang, Shichao Zhang, Qingyu Li, Ying‐Ming Pan, Heng‐Shan Wang, Jun Cheng, Hongqiang Wang and Xiaofeng Zhu.
